WebOct 21, 2015 · 2. Let A B C be a triangle with A B = A C. If D is the mid-point of B C, E is the foot of perpendicular drawn from D to A C and F is the midpoint of D E, then prove that A F is perpendicular to B E. This problem came in IITJEE exam. I know how to prove it algebraically: by taking B as ( − a, 0) and C as ( a, 0), D as ( 0, 0), A as ( 0, h) etc.
WebMar 24, 2024 · The perpendicular foot, also called the foot of an altitude, is the point on the leg opposite a given vertex of a triangle at which the perpendicular passing through that vertex intersects the side.
